### Changed defaults

The Pindlemere kiosk watchdog now defaults to a 20-second heartbeat (previously 10) and restarts the shell after two misses instead of three. This reduces false restarts on slow boot hardware observed in the Harnswick fleet. Future maintainers: override per-site only via fleet policy. The new defaults are as follows.

service settings:
WENATH_PIN=5007
WENATH_METRICS_HOST=metrics.wenath.tolvaqlabs.corp
WENATH_LOG_LEVEL=debug
WENATH_TENANT=rusox

Handover — report exports, timezone handling.

All Driftlane report exports are stored UTC; rendering converts to the workspace timezone at export time, not scheduling time. So a "daily 9am" report can shift an hour around DST — expected, not a bug. Support will see tickets about "missing" rows near midnight; it's almost always a timezone boundary. Do not patch timestamps manually. Known edge cases, the DST calendar, and canned ticket responses are all collected on the internal page below.

wiki page, bawef-hafop: https://jira.nelvroworks.corp/job/pages/projects/7c5c0f440dbd

**Mgmt Meeting Minutes — Retiring the Brightline Range**

Quick recap for sales leads at Fenholt Supplies: we agreed to retire the Brightline fixture range by year-end. Remaining stock moves to clearance pricing next month, and accounts on standing orders get migrated to the Lumetta range. Trade-in incentives were approved in principle. The confidential note on next steps sits just below.

board note of bajof-bajeg: The pricing group signed off on a budget of $13.4 million for Project Sildor. The renewal with Lamixek Holdings closes at $48.9 million a year, 49 percent above the last contract.

Onboarding: the Reelsmith transcoding farm. Customer uploads land in the intake queue, get split into segments, and fan out across worker nodes; a merge step reassembles outputs per preset. Typical turnaround is under ten minutes — jobs stuck longer are usually waiting on a failed segment retry, which support can requeue from the dashboard. Never cancel a job in the merge phase. Status meanings, requeue steps, and escalation criteria are on the page below.

runbook for badug-kadup: https://confluence.zemvarlabs.internal/projects/browse/display/projects/bd1b